An exciting interfaith Outreach opportunity is in the works. We are hoping to collaborate with youth (middle school and high school age) and adults from other churches on the island to participate in Heeling Our World. Heeling Our World is a project which impacts and improves the lives of children both in the U.S. and in Africa. It addresses the issue of the 300 million barefoot children around the world who are at risk of disease and death due to lack of footwear. In the U.S. this project raises awareness among students and gives them a pathway to advocacy. Looking specifically at shoes for children, a simple design called KLEM, made from locally sourced materials, are provided to barefoot children. We can be a part of this initiative by learning to make these simply designed shoes, and providing them to the children. On Saturday, March 25 from 2-4 pm, Mitch Lewis, Executive Director, will lead a workshop for St Francis and interested persons from other local churches to learn about Heeling Our World and learn to make these simple KLEM shoes. All materials will be provided and no sewing skills are required. Any questions, see Denise Throckmorton or Barbara McCreary. Charlie McCurry, Lisa Park, Carol Eaton, and Sandy Quinn Search Committee for Youth Minister Disturb Us, Lord contributed by Bill and Becky Clingman Disturb us, Lord, when We are too pleased with ourselves, When our dreams have become true Because we dreamed too little, When we arrived safely Because we sailed too close to the shore. Disturb us, Lord, when With the abundance of things we possess, We have lost our thirst For the waters of life; Having fallen in love with life, We have ceased to dream of eternity. And in our efforts to build a new earth, We have allowed our vision Of the new Heaven to dim. Disturb us, Lord, to dare more boldly, To venture on wider seas Where storms will show Your masters; Where losing sight of land, We shall find the stars. We ask You to push back The Horizons of our hopes; And to push us in the future In strength, courage, hope, and love. This we ask in the name of our captain, Who is Jesus Christ. Portsmouth, England, This prayer was written on the departure of Sir Francis Drake s one-ship expedition in the Golden Hinde to be the first person in history to circumnavigate the world.

6 Page 6 Ecumenical Cycle of Prayer by Barbara McCreary Each week during Prayers of the People we pray cyclically for churches in our diocese. In addition to the diocesan cycle, we will be adding an ecumenical cycle in which we will pray for churches of other denominations near to us. Every Sunday you will hear the names of two churches from a list of 71 compiled from locations in Bogue Banks, Morehead City, Newport, Beaufort, Cape Carteret, and Swansboro. We will notify the church via post card the date on which we will be praying for the first time for their church, including the following words: We pray that the work you do to further God's Kingdom in the world will continue to be blessed. Let your light so shine before men, that they may see your good works, and glorify your Father which is in heaven." Matthew 5:16 KJV It's easy for these churches to become part of a blurred landscape that mean nothing to us as we speed along 58 or 24, but these are the churches of our neighbors, friends, relatives, and the people in our community with which we do business on a daily basis. By praying for these churches, our hope is that you will feel increasingly connected to those in our community who also serve God. When you drive by one of the many, many churches in our area for which we have prayed, some small, some large, all beautiful in its way, we hope it will have a deeper meaning for you.
